IVR, Interactive Voice Response, self attendant, personal attendant, voice menu, voice tree, is one of the things this bizarre society of last decades has made all of us extremely familiar with. From call centres to voice mail systems, from the wakeup call of our youth (our fathers' youth?) to airport information systems, we're used to interact with a (synthetic?) voice through the digits we press on the dialpad.
So, call 5000 from one of the phones and interact with a simple but complete IVR, with many options, menus and submenus. Some of the choices you can make from the demo IVR are also extensions in their own right.
